"Dawson Tree Solutions: Nurturing Mother nature, A single Tree which has a Time"
In the heart of Australia, during which the vibrant landscapes and numerous ecosystems coalesce, stands a firm focused on preserving the neatest thing about mother nature. Dawson Tree Expert services, situated in Australia, has emerged for a stalwart guardian Using the surroundings, providing An array of companies geared toward guaranteeing this an